he yin and her husband lin zhongjie know just how it feels to be single children. they both grew up in one-child households, and they wonder if that's the best environment for their son. "one obvious feature of our generation is a strong sense of loneliness... most of us were growing grew up without the company of siblings or cousins which results in some flaws in interpersonal communication and sense of responsibility." >> but unlike their parents, they have a choice. shanghai and some other cities and provinces have slightly relaxed the rules to allow parents who are both only children to have two of their own.
